Basic Site Details

Name: Royal Bank of Scotland
Town, district or village: Keith
City or county: Banffshire
Country: Scotland
Parish:  
Status:  
Grid ref:
Notes: Described in the Builder as the "Royal Bank of Scotland and law offices." It is assumed that these offices occupied the upper floor.
